The Truth About Heart Disease:
-
Almost one million Americans die of heart disease each year. It’s the leading cause of death among men and women
-
Kills more people than all cancers combined
-
One half of all heart attacks occur in patients with low to moderate cholesterol levels
-
Heart disease has killed more women than men every year since 1984
-
Stroke is the leading cause of disability among adults in the U.S.
-
The right testing can reveal the risks and help prevent heart disease.

If caught early enough, heart disease can be prevented in just about all patients.
